I have noticed that people have had similar problems with these types of software (Movie Factory, DVD Builder, Nero Vision Express). These all-in-one apps, usually do not do a good job on everything. You would be better off using a separate program for encoding your files to DVD format and then importing the .VOB files into Movie Factory. It should not have to re-encode.

My experience is that WinAvi is the fastest and has acceptible quality. Then there are programs like TMPGEnc, Mainconcept, and CCE which will do a better job, but will take a lot longer (though you can change settings to make them reasonably fast).

You can try all of them for free, I would not suggest getting hooked on CCE as that one is about $2000. Mainconcept is around $150, TMPGEnc is around $40 and WinAvi is about $30. I do not know what files each accept, but WinAvi should convert just about everything.
